How can frontline employees build trust and credibility with management in order to successfully advocate for their feedback and drive positive change in the workplace?
Frontline employees can build trust and credibility with management by consistently demonstrating their expertise, professionalism, and commitment to the organization's goals. They can also actively seek out opportunities to communicate their feedback and ideas in a constructive and solution-oriented manner. Building strong relationships with supervisors and showing a willingness to collaborate and problem-solve can also help frontline employees gain the trust and support of management. By consistently delivering results, being transparent in their communication, and actively contributing to the success of the team, frontline employees can establish themselves as valuable advocates for positive change in the workplace.
